Stay Organized

Attending an online university does give you more flexibility and time when completing your degree, but you still want to keep on top of it all. A great idea is to keep a diary, either an actual, physical, diary or one on your smartphone. This way you know what work needs to be done for your course and you can also pencil in fun sightseeing trips for wherever you are in the world!

Essential Technology

Having the correct technology is essential. Since you are studying an online degree it means that you’ll need a good internet connection to complete those assignments. So you’ll defiantly need a Mi-Fi/USB dongle. These are small, portable devices that mean you can connect to the internet wherever you are, rather than having to rely on finding Wi-Fi connections at hotels or cafes. It is also a good idea to carry a smartphone or tablet, maybe even a small laptop if you find it easier working on one. You don’t want to be carrying anything too bulky when traveling, but you still want to be able to work easily.
